Shanta Thake named to a top post at Lincoln Center


Thake has spent most of her professional career at the Public, which has proved in recent years to be an extraordinary launchpad for next-generation arts leaders: Both Maria Goyanes and Stephanie Ybarra were lured from the Public to become the artistic directors of Woolly Mammoth Theatre in Washington and Center Stage in Baltimore, respectively. At the Public, Thake, who holds degrees in theater and management from Indiana University, started in a clerical job under the then artistic leader, George C. Wolfe. Eventually, she moved up to associate artistic director for artistic programs under the Public’s current head, Oskar Eustis.
